This last dance

Brynlee

The sun dances across the stagnant sky

In a fair waltz with the moon and stars

I see it in your eyes in the moment

Sometimes I will see sadness in your sky

The type of sadness that everyone feels

But can never be akin to others

The type of sadness that i've always held

but can never think to ever speak of 

But in this graceful waltz here and now 

though I see that vulnerability 

You seem to accept it unlike I do

I see you in my nights infinite sky 

Every last star and moon in every life

That last dance in my this twilight
